Assigned to preserve Knowledge, encyclopedias record its respective temporality. Commonly they arise at the threshold of changes in meaning and understanding. The Encyclopedia of Jewish History and Culture (EJHC) reflects a state of knowledge assembled with respect to a complex transition.
